Transforming PointCloud2

I would like to know if somebody knows what is the substitute for the function of transformPointCloud() for PointCloud2 data type as in this question. I've tried to go to the link provided but it seems to be deprecated(I guess) as I cannot find in my autocompletion mode.

You had found the correct answer: pcl_ros::transformPointCloud() is the function to call.

The generated documentation link may have changed. Try looking for it starting with the main pcl_ros API page.

You can transform using the tf2_sensor_msgs (both C++ and Python interface, since at least Indigo):

#include <tf2_sensor_msgs.h>
#include <sensor_msgs/PointCloud2.h>
#include <geometry_msgs/TransformStamped.h>

const sensor_msgs::PointCloud2 cloud_in, cloud_out;
const geometry_msgs::TransformStamped transform;
// TODO load everything
tf2::doTransform (cloud_in, cloud_out, transform);

Or in Python:

from tf2_sensor_msgs.tf2_sensor_msgs import do_transform_cloud
cloud_out = do_transform_cloud(cloud_in, transform)

None of the codes was really tested, though I intend to use them tomorrow. If you test them and find a bug, please edit my answer. I really wonder why there aren't more tutorials for this kind of essential conversions.
